A mobile closing means the signing appointment takes place at a location that is convenient for the borrower or signer rather than at a title office.

Our attorneys travel to the location of the signer to complete the closing documents, making the process easier and more flexible for everyone involved.

Most signing appointments take 30–60 minutes, depending on the type of loan and the number of documents involved.

Our attorneys guide the signer through the documents efficiently while still making sure everything is properly executed.
